A bunker sits at 245.0 yards off the tee, catching mid-length drives for players who carry the ball 240-250 yards. Consider club selection that lands short of or well past this distance to avoid the sand.
With the hole playing only 371 yards, longer hitters should be cautious of the bunker cluster at 325.4 and 351.0 yards, which guard the layup and approach zones. A controlled 3-wood or long iron leaving 100-120 yards may be the smarter play.
The green is classified as small at just 3389 sq ft (32 yards by 21 yards), demanding precise distance control on the approach. Favor a club that guarantees you hit the putting surface rather than challenging pins tucked near the edges.
Given the green's compact 32-yard by 21-yard dimensions, misjudged approach shots can easily find one of the surrounding bunkers at 325.4 or 351.0 yards. Aim for the center of the green to minimize short-side misses.
Three bunkers strategically placed at 245.0, 325.4, and 351.0 yards create a gauntlet for this par 4. Plan your tee shot and layup distances carefully to thread between these hazards for the best angle into the small green.
